Rockets are now 21-14 thanks to a new win to try to make post season.

On the other hand Lakers are questionable for post season as they dropped their fourth straight to fall to a poor 15-19 record.

They are in the 11th place in the tough Western Conference.

On the beginning of the game The Rockets did not  withstand great strain made by Lakers as the Lakers led 18-4 early after a play where World Peace hit two 3-pointers and Darius Morris made one.   ” Get a hold of yourself dudes ” ! said coach Kevin McHale.

Houston listened to the coach and used a 12-5  slashing spurt powered by two 3s from versatile Delfino to cut the lead to 34-28 at the end of the first quarter. Rockets finally trailed by 3 at halftime . Los Angeles lead 62-59.

And Texas Men found their path in the second half to overcome a biggest  Lakers lead of 14. Houston scored a total of 66 points after the half while Lakers scored only 50.

To win this game Houston was carried by a slashing James Harden at the top his game behind 31 points on 11-for-19 shooting.

A perfect production with the charity stripe with 8 throw connected. He is now 300 free trow made.

Chandler Parsons added 20 and Jeremy Lin chipped in 19 points. Harden matched Moses Malone’s franchise record for most consecutive games with at least 25 units. Harden has 13th consecutive 25-points production.

He should top this record in the next game vs New Orleans. Harden has averaged an inspiring 29,4 points during this 13 games.

For the Lakers , World Peace had a season-high 24 points. The best scorer in the league dropped only 20 points and Nash had a double double with 16 points and 10 dimes. Nash recorded his 10,000 career assist on an A.Jamison basket with 19,6 seconds remaining in the season quarter. He’s the fourth fastest to reach that mark.

He needed 1162 contests including 10 games with the purple and yellow jersey.

Lakers were playing this game without their strong towers, D.Howard, P.Gasol and Hill, missing all the game because of injuries.

He became the fifth player to surpass 10,000 career assists , joining a prestigious club held by John Stockton,  who breast-fed  Karl Malone to record a great record of 15 806 assists. Jason Kidd,  who is the best active player in career assists numbers is the second best in this list.

This list includes also Mark Jackson, the current coach of  the surprising rising Golden State Warriors squad who is doing a remarkable job to push this team.

Last but not least , you find in this list Magic Jonhson, who accomplished an impressive career in Lakers as a versatile point guard able to play everywhere in the court ! Steve Nash, joined this club, because he has talent !

Jeremy Lin and James Harden, the two Rockets J collected 50 points on 18 for 33 shooting.

The Rockets secured a second win this season vs The Knicks 109 96.

J.Lin , the former star rising Knicks, dropped 22 points and delivered 8 assists at Madison Square Garden, while James Harden scored 28 points and pulled down 10 rebounds to avoid  Knicks’s second chance.

The Rockets backcourt was truly in the game whereas J.Kidd and R.Felton were stunned by Rockets guards as they contributed for only 19 points on 9 for 27 shooting.

Lin who is 17,5 PPG against  BIG APPLE  has beaten twice this season New York by a combined 41 points.

Lin reached the 20-point plateau for the third time this season.

We want to see more. Lin the 3rd Harvard student since 1947 in the NBA, after Saul Mariaschin and Ed Smith, needs to have more impact.

Jose Calderon’s triple double led Toronto to a second win in a row. Raptors trounced Houston 103-96.

The 31 years old spanish point guard , went for his second triple double in his career with 18 points, 14 assists and 10 rebounds.

Toronto Raptors wins two in a row for the first time in eight long months.

He added tight defense to his offensive performance. Jeremy Lin, his matchup finished just with only 7 points and 2 assists in 41 minutes.

The Spanish point guard started in place of the injured Kyle Lowry who missed the last three games. Raptors are 2-1 in this split.

Calderon  has been a perennial backup in Toronto . He has been playing with this organisation since the  2005/2006 season.

Calderon with his second triple double is the leader in that category. He’s also the first to reach two triple double.
